What advancement occurred in fire fighting technology by 1860?

Explanation:
The acceptance of the horse-drawn steam engine was a significant advancement in firefighting technology by 1860. This innovation marked a shift from hand-operated devices and enabled firefighters to transport water more rapidly and in greater quantities than ever before. The steam engine allowed for increased pressure and the ability to deliver water over longer distances, which was crucial for fighting larger and more destructive fires. This technology represented a move towards mechanization in firefighting, paving the way for future advancements and improving the overall efficiency and effectiveness of fire response efforts. While other options such as water tankers, chemical fire extinguishers, and motorized fire trucks represent important developments in firefighting, they occurred either later in history or did not achieve the same level of impact during that specific period. The horse-drawn steam engine stands out as a key evolution in fire service capabilities at that time.
